If you are signed into your Google account, each time you leave a message on a Blogger blog the link will point to your Blogger profile unless the blogger has enabled name/url. From a blogger's perspective each time a link is left in this manner link love goes to the Blogger profile page with no link love going to the commenter's blog. This creates a hole in your PR and if you have a large number of them can create a rather large hole in your PR. An workaround solution was to manually strip the url which does work nicely unless you have a lot of commenters. An easier solution is to change the template HTML by removing a small piece of code. How to remove the links to commenter's profiles was gratiously shared in the Blogger Help forum. This is a nice solution because it removes the work of having manually remove these types of links.
